Proceeding contribution from Danny Alexander (Liberal Democrat) in the House of Commons on Thursday, 17 June 2010. It occurred during Ministerial statement on Public Spending.
Public Spending
I was not aware of that Department's spending on luxury sofas—perhaps I should have been. It is precisely that kind of expenditure on which we need to bear down heavily in the context of the spending review and through the efficiency and reform group that we have established, to ensure the maximum amount of space in Departments' budgets to spend on the front-line services that Members on both sides of the House care about.
